Come join the MapMyFitness team at Outside as a Senior iOS Engineer. In this role, you will build software that helps millions of users track, analyze, and share their fitness journeys. You will work closely with our small and mighty team of engineers alongside our peers in growth marketing, product and design.
MapMyFitness is not just any fitness tracking app, it's a powerful platform that empowers people to achieve their fitness goals and connect with a community of like-minded individuals. At MapMyFitness our North Star is to provide our users with the very best tools to track, analyze, and improve their fitness activities.
What you will do:
- Lead development of new features for the MapMyFitness iOS app
- Collaborate with marketing, product, and design peers to ship great user experiences
- Respond proactively to bugs and make continuous improvements for the MapMyFitness community
- Assist with monitoring and resolving incidents, ensuring high availability
This describes you:
- You have 7+ years experience in iOS development
- You are proficient with Swift, Objective-C, SwiftUI, and UIKit, and are familiar with other parts of our stack: Core Data, Core Location, HealthKit
- You are very familiar with using shared libraries
- Debugging code in XCode is a breeze
- You are a strong communicator in a fully remote environment
- You can clearly explain technical concepts to non-technical stakeholders
- You are able to work independently in situations of ambiguity
- You have experience shipping maintainable and testable code bases
- You can build and integrate RESTful APIs in mobile applications
- You have contributed to major architectural changes on products used by millions of users
Nice to have:
- Passion for fitness, running and familiarity with the MapMyFitness community
- Experience with workout tracking and GPS-based applications
- Background in performance optimization and battery efficiency
- Experience with Gitflow, Fastlane, and Bitrise but we’re also open to other workflows
